1. 求批处理, 指定目录下有多个文件夹和文件,只删除包含有指定字符的文件夹(不管文件夹里有没有内容)
del /f/s/q *.* ;删除所有目录和子目录下的文件rd /s/q *.* ;删除所有目录和子目录指定文件名是指定的相通字符不变,用通配符*用来替代文件名中不同字符。
2. linux下如何批量将文件夹名称中的某些字符串删去
可以通过shell脚本来实现,脚本中的命令如下for file_old in `ls`; dofile_new=`echo "$file_old" | sed 's/The//g'` mv $file_old $file_new这样就把文件名中含有The的文内件转变容为了不含The的文件
3. Linux中如何删除名为-a及\a的文件及特殊文件
a 删除名为 -a 的文件1 rm ./-a2 rm — -a,–告诉rm这是一个选项,具体参见getopt3 ls -i 列出inum,然后用find . -inum inum_of_thisfile -exec rm '{}' \;b 删除名为 \a 的文件rm \\ac 删除名字带的 / 和‘ \0 ' 文件这些字符是正常文件系统所不允许的字符,但可能在文件名中产生,如unix下的nfs文件系统在Mac系统上使用1 把nfs文件系统在挂到不过滤'/'字符的系统下,删除含特殊文件名的文件;2 将错误文件名的目录其它文件移走,ls -id 显示含该文件目录的inum,umount 文件系统,clri清除该目录的inum,fsck,mount,检查lost+found目录,将其中的文件更名。另外,可以通过windows ftp过去删除任何文件名的文件d 删除名字带不可见字符的文件列出文件名并转储到文件:ls -l del.sh然后编辑文件的内容加入rm命令使其内容成为删除上述文件的格式:vi del.shrm -rf *******执行sh del.she 删除文件大小为零的文件
4. linux 删除问题 一次删除多个目录下的相同扩展名的文件
示例:一次性删除某目录及其子目录下所有以.exe为后缀的文件。find . -name '*.exe' -type f -print -exec rm -rf {} \;说明:find:使用find命令搜索文件,使用它的-name参数指明文件后缀名。. :是当前目录,因为Linux是树形目录,所以总有一个交集目录,这里根据需要设置'*.exe': 指明后缀名,*是通配符" -type f : "查找的类型为文件"-print" :输出查找的文件目录名-exec: -exec选项后边跟着一个所要执行的命令,表示将find出来的文件或目录执行该命令。注意:exec选项后面跟随着所要执行的命令或脚本,然后是一对儿{},一个空格和一个\,最后是一个分号。
5. Linux 中如何删除含有同一字符的文件
ls -l ~/test/ | awk -F. '{a[$1]=$0;b[NR]=$0;if(length(b[NR-1])<length(a[$1])&&NR!=1)print b[NR-1]}'
6. 请问linux怎样删除某一个目录下所有指定文件名的文件
1、先使用SSH连接工具进入到linux系统中。
注意事项:
linux除了在服务器操作系统方面保持着强劲的发展势头以外,在个人电脑、嵌入式系统上都有着长足的进步。使用者不仅可以直观地获取该操作系统的实现机制,而且可以根据自身的需要来修改完善这个操作系统,使其最大化地适应用户的需要。
7. linux 查找包含关键字的所有文件并删除该文件。
|
1、连接上相应的linux主机,进入到等待输入shell指令的linux命令行状态下。
8. linux怎么删除目录下以某个字母或者某个词开头的所有文件
删除开头抄的 rm -rf /home/myuser/a* 即是在袭/home/myuser/a开头的所有文件都会被删除*的含义表示任意字符任意长度。
9. linux删除当前文件及子文件夹目录下的带abc的文件
rm 文件名:删除文件 rmdir 文件夹名:删除空文件夹,若不为空,该命令无效 rm -r 文件夹名:强制删除非空文件夹
10. Linux主机文件管理里怎么删除有特殊字符的文件夹啊
用rm命令删rm -ir *只有要删的输入y删除,其它输入n保留
未经允许不得转载:山九号 » linux删除目录下带同字符的文件|linux 查找包含关键字的所有文件并删除该文件